Abstract

The development of geometric abilities is very important for early childhood. This research was aimed to determine the description of the ability to recognize geometric shapes in children aged 5-6 years at Canda Mulia Kindergarten, Batang Kulim Village 6, Pangkalan Kuras District. This research was used a quantitative descriptive approach. The sample to be take by researchers is 18 children at Canda Mulia Kindergarten, Batang Kulim Village, Pangkalan Kuras District. The sample was used is 18 children. The data analysis technique was used a percentage formula. The results of this research was showed that the ability to recognize geometric shapes in the aspect of recognizing geometric shapes based on color, shape and size obtained a percentage of 72.22% with the category developing according to expectations, the aspect of matching geometric objects obtained a percentage of 69.44% with the category developing according to expectations, the aspect of comparing geometric shapes obtained a percentage of 55.56% with the category starting to develop and the aspect of mentioning geometric objects obtained a percentage of 65.28%. It can be concluded that the ability to recognize geometric shapes in children aged 5-6 years at Canda Mulia Kindergarten, Batang Kulim Village reached 65.63% which is in the range of 56%-75% with the criteria of Developing According to Expectations (BSH)
